PANAMA CITY - Northwest Florida Beaches International Airport, the first commercial international airport to be built in the U.S. in past 15 years, begins operations May 23.
To celebrate this historic event, a ribbon-cutting grand opening celebration will be held May 22 from 9 a.m. to 4:30 p.m.
The event is open to the public, and will feature live music, F-15 flyover, speeches and the arrival of the first Southwest Airlines plane.
Speakers include Gov. Charlie Crist, Sen. Bill Nelson, Congressman Allen Boyd, Airport Authority Chairman Joe Tannehill, Bob Montgomery, Southwest Airlines Vice President ? Properties, and Britt Greene, Chief Executive Officer of The St. Joe Company.
